Alkanes
Hydrocarbons that contain only C-C single bonds in their molecules are called alkanes. These include open chain as well as closed chain (cyclic) hydrocarbons. For example, ethane, propane cyclopentane. Alkanes are further divided into: Open chain or acyclic (simple alkane..

Conformations of Alkanes and Cycloalkanes
The carbon-carbon bonds in alkanes result from sigma overlap of two tetrahedral carbon sp 3 orbitals. Sigma bonds result from the head-on overlap of two atomic orbitals, and that they are cylindrically symmetrical. The cross section of a sigma orbital is circular. Due to this sigma..
